首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Moodle,如何添加自定义jQuery脚本以在所有页面上运行

Moodle是一个开源的在线学习管理系统(Learning Management System,LMS),它提供了一套完整的教育教学解决方案。Moodle的核心功能包括在线课程管理、作业提交、学习资源分享、在线测试和讨论等。

要在Moodle的所有页面上运行自定义jQuery脚本,你可以按照以下步骤进行操作:

  1. 登录Moodle后台管理界面。
  2. 点击“站点管理”选项卡,然后选择“外观”下的“主题”。
  3. 在主题设置页面,你可以选择一个当前正在使用的主题或者创建一个自定义主题。点击“设置”按钮来编辑该主题的设置。
  4. 在主题编辑页面,你可以找到一个名为“自定义脚本”或类似的选项。这通常可以在“自定义CSS/JS”或“定制代码”部分找到。
  5. 在该选项下,你可以添加自定义的jQuery脚本代码。你可以使用<script>标签将脚本包裹起来,并使用jQuery提供的API进行DOM操作、事件处理等。
  6. 添加完自定义的jQuery脚本后,记得保存设置。

自定义jQuery脚本的应用场景包括但不限于以下几个方面:

  • 添加自定义交互效果:你可以使用jQuery来为Moodle的页面添加各种交互效果,例如动画效果、弹出窗口等,以增强用户体验。
  • 修改默认功能行为:如果你需要修改Moodle的某些默认功能行为,例如更改表单提交的方式、验证表单输入等,使用自定义jQuery脚本可以实现。
  • 增加额外的功能:你可以使用jQuery与Moodle的API进行交互,实现一些额外的功能,例如自定义的表单验证、数据统计等。

关于推荐的腾讯云相关产品,这里只提供部分可能与Moodle相关的产品,具体选择取决于你的需求和实际情况:

  1. 云服务器(Elastic Compute Cloud,EC2):提供可扩展的虚拟服务器,为Moodle提供可靠的计算资源。产品介绍链接
  2. 对象存储(Cloud Object Storage,COS):用于存储和访问Moodle中的各种教学资源,如课件、图片等。产品介绍链接
  3. 云数据库MySQL版(TencentDB for MySQL):提供可靠的数据库服务,用于存储Moodle的数据。产品介绍链接
  4. CDN加速(Content Delivery Network):加速Moodle中的静态资源(如图片、CSS、JS文件)的传输,提高用户访问速度。产品介绍链接
  5. 云安全中心(Cloud Security Center):提供全面的安全服务,帮助保护Moodle的安全性。产品介绍链接

注意:以上推荐的腾讯云产品仅供参考,具体使用与否需根据实际需求进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何在Ubuntu 16.04上安装Moodle

本教程中,您将在Ubuntu 16.04服务器上安装和设置Moodle。您将安装和配置Moodle所需的所有软件,运行设置向导,选择主题并创建第一个课程。...我们安装Moodle之前,让我们使用包管理器安装所有必备库。...“ 数据库设置”页面上,输入您在第三步中创建的Moodle MySQL用户的用户名和密码。其他字段可以保留原样。单击“ 下一步”继续。 按“ 继续”,查看许可协议并确认您同意其条款。...第四步 - 自定义Moodle并创建您的第一个课程 现在您的网站正在运行,您当晚要做的第一件事就是注册您的Moodle网站。这将订阅Moodle邮件列表,让您及时了解安全警报和新版本等内容。...你的第一个Moodle课程现在准备好了。您可以使用Moodle的界面开始课程项里添加课程和活动。 但在您开始让人们注册参加新课程之前,您应确保您的Moodle安装已准备好投入生产。

4.1K20

还在为选择办公软件而烦恼吗?不妨试试ONLYofficeV8.0

自动运行宏或对其自动启动进行限制。 三.优势三幻灯片 1.构建任何复杂程度的内容 用自选形状和 SmartArt 图形创建清晰的方案和草图,添加自定义的图表、表格和方程,以获得独特的统计显示。...4.与 Moodle 集成 8.0 版中,将 Moodle(一个免费的开源学习管理系统)添加到支持的云提供商中。...这意味着现在用户可以直接从桌面应用程序编辑存储 Moodle 平台中的文档,并使用桌面套件中提供的所有功能,包括本地插件、字体、打印服务和拼写检查。...路径: 开始窗口 -> 连接到云 -> Moodle 5.用密码保护 PDF 文件 ONLYOFFICE 桌面编辑器的更新版本中,用户现在可以更安全地处理 PDF 文件。...路径:“文件”选项卡 -> 保护 ->添加密码 6.从“开始”菜单快速创建文档 Windows 上使用 ONLYOFFICE 桌面编辑器时,现在用户无需单击桌面上的应用程序图标即可创建新的文档、表单模板

17810
  • Wijmo 更优美的jQuery UI部件集:从wijwizard和wijpager开始

    在这个快速入门,你将学习如何向一个HTML工程添加众多Wijmo部件中的两个,wijwizard 以及 wijpager。...你将从添加并且自定义一个wijwizard部件入手,可以了解到一些独特的功能,然后你将学习如何通过连接到wijpager部件对wijwizard添加分页导航支持。...同时元素的标识符被设置成“pages”,你将在接下来通过jQuery访问这个元素以完成对部件的初始化。 请注意,为了向部件添加,你所要做的只是将文本放置一对标签中间。...这里我们会让你这么做,因为你之前没有见过它是如何工作的。 首先,添加一个的HTML元素到工程。...使用Wijmo,你总是可以很容易的自定义你的部件。你通过这个快速入门获得的大多数知识可以应用到其他Wijmo部件,但是这只是所有你能通过Wijmo实现功能的冰山一角。

    2.5K70

    jQuery EasyUI 详解

    官网地址:http://www.jeasyui.com/index.php 文档地址: 中文文档 英文文档 快速入门 弹出对话框 demo 第一步: 下载 Jquery EasyUI 你使用和进行开发时...目前官方最新版本是:jQuery EasyUI 1.5,官方提供了两个版本供下载,GPL 版本和商业版本,你根据自己的需要下载 GPL 版本 GPL 版本 GPl 协议下有效,你能在任何遵循 GPl...getRows none 返回当前的行。 getFooterRows none 返回部的行。...getSelections none 返回所有选中的行,当没有选中的记录时,将返回空数组。 clearSelections none 清除所有的选择。...selectAll none 选中当前所有的行。 unselectAll none 取消选中当前所有的行。 selectRow index 选中一行,行索引从 0 开始。

    9.2K10

    bootstrap-table数据导出Excel 、JSON、txt、pdf等

    四、参数解释(来自bootstrap-table官网) 1、showExport(是否显示导出按钮) 属性:data-show-export 类型: Boolean 详情:设置true为导出表。...basic:只导出当前 all:导出所有数据 selected:导出选中的数据 默认: basic 4、exportTypes(导出文件类型) 属性: data-export-types 类型: Array...默认: false 6、Icons(导出图标) export: 'glyphicon-export icon-share' 五、服务端分页和客户端分页   所谓客户端模式,指的是服务器中把要显示到表格的数据一次性加载出来...,然后转换成JSON格式传到要显示的界面中,客户端模式较为简单,它是把数据一次性加载出来放到界面上,然后根据你设置的每页记录数,自动生成分页。...当点击第二时,会自动加载出数据,不会再向服务器发送请求。同时用户可以使用其自带的搜索功能,可以实现全数据搜索。对于数据量较少的时候,可以使用这个方法。

    3.5K20

    Spring 全家桶之 Spring Boot 2.6.4(五)- WebMvcAutoConfiguration(Part A)

    addResourceHandlers 方法是用于定义资源访问的,这个方法中添加了webjars的访问路径;也就是说所有的/webjars/** ,都可以去类路径下既classpath:/META-INF...pom文件中添加jQuery的jar包 org.webjars jquery</artifactId...Spring Boot 中的WelcomePageHandlerMapping类中定义了欢迎的配置 也就是说 / 路径会转发到 静态资源文件夹下的index.html页面上 浏览器输入localhos...:8080 根据页面显示默认找到了META-INF/resources目录下的index.html文件作为欢迎 自定义静态资源路径 WebProperties下的Resources类属性中有一个...setStaticLocations方法,该方法可以自定义静态文件夹的路径 properties配置文件中配置自定义的静态资源路径 # 覆盖以前所有的静态资源路径 spring.web.resources.static-locations

    36410

    Windows 罕见技巧全集3

    3.关闭所有窗口 如果在“我的电脑”中打开了一层层的子目录,你可以最低层目录窗口中,按住 Shift键,再用鼠标点击“×”按钮,则可以关闭所有目录窗体。 4....5.最小化所有窗口 想一次性最小化所有打开的窗口,可以用鼠标右键单击“任务栏”上的空白区域,选择“最小化所有窗口”。...这时鼠标会变成十字型,用鼠标幻灯片上拖动画出播放Flash的区域,在其上单击鼠标右键,选择属性,弹出属性对话框,单击自定义后边“…”,弹出属性对话框,输入Flash文件的地址。...首先在中文Word2000菜单中选择“工具栏选项中的“自定义命令,进入“自定义编辑“界面,然后自定义编辑“界面中选择命令卡,并移动光标条到类别栏中的“字体项“,“字体项“ 有字体,此时就可以通过使用鼠标直接将相应的字体拖曳到工具栏上...67.恢复消失了的“我的电脑” 你可以面上点击鼠标右键,选择“属性 →效果”,把“按Web查看桌面时隐藏图标”前的对勾去掉,然后点确定即可;另外一种方法就是,鼠标右键弹出的菜单中选择

    1.5K10

    Web前端学习笔记之JavaScript、jQuery、AJAX、JSON的区别

    动态语言指的是程序运行时可以改变结构,主要体现在: ① js中的变量声明的时候不需要指定类型,其实际类型由程序运行中的赋值决定,在运行过程中变量的类型也可以改变。...③ 对象的成员可变,可以动态添加、删除成员属性或成员方法。 弱类型指的是js中的变量参与运算的时候可以根据实际需要动态转换类型。...jQuery出现之前,js程序中获取元素节点比较麻烦,例如获取id为elem1的节点 document.getElementById('elem1') 或者是获取页面上所有checkbox元素,首先需要获取...而异步方式则不会阻塞浏览器进程,服务端返回数据并触发回调函数之前,用户依然可以该页面上进行其他操作。ajax的核心是异步方式,而同步方式只有极其特殊的情况下才会被用到。...ajax领域中JSON取代XML的过程,是一个很好的“用投票”的范例。 而JSON的影响力在此后还继续扩大,有些软件将其作为配置文件的格式,有些编程语言也吸纳了JSON的优点。

    2.2K20

    SpringBoot之静态资源的访问与管理

    我们不妨运行来做一个测试。 会发现他返回的其实是aaa,而不是这张图片了。 原理: 请求进来,先去找Controller看能不能处理。不能处理的所有请求又都交给静态资源处理器。...静态资源也找不到则响应404面 我们一般希望所有的静态资源的访问路径都有一个前缀,可以通过application.properties配置文件中添加如下的配置来实现: spring.mvc.static-path-pattern...下面简单的来介绍一下webjar的基本使用: (1) maven中央仓库中搜索我们需要的webjar,如jquery (2)然后pom.xml中添加依赖: <!...(这里给运行没有反应的各位提一点建议,就是把target目录删掉然后重新运行) 4.自定义index欢迎 静态资源路径下index.html ,由于我们上面配置了默认的静态资源路径为classpath...5.自定义favicon 这个favicon就是我们网站的小图标。我们的网站也可以自定义这样得一个小图标。

    87050

    最新Tampermonkey 中文文档解析(附基础案例和高级案例)

    @author 脚本的作者 @description 简短重要的描述 @homepage, @homepageURL, @website and @source “选项”上用于从脚本名链接到给定的作者主页...如果用户单击此按钮,则将自动允许所有未来的请求。 用户还可以通过“脚本设置”选项卡的用户域白名单中添加“*”来白名单所有请求。...如果@grant后跟“none”,沙盒将被禁用,脚本将直接在页面上下文中运行。在此模式下,没有gm_u*函数,但gm_u info属性将可用。...示例 // @grant none @noframes 这个标签表明脚本主页面上运行,而不是iframes里 @unwrap 这个标签是被忽略的,因为他谷歌浏览器里不需要 @nocompat 目前...这就是为什么tm支持这个标签来禁用运行为firefox/greasemonkey编写的脚本所需的所有优化。要保持此标记可扩展,可以添加可由脚本处理的浏览器名称。

    5.3K11

    作为面试官,为什么我推荐微前端作为前端面试的亮点?

    使用 qiankun 时,如果子应用是基于 jQuery 的多应用,你会如何处理静态资源的加载问题?...使用 qiankun 时,如果子应用是基于 jQuery 的多应用,静态资源的加载问题可能会成为一个挑战。这是因为微前端环境中,子应用的静态资源路径可能需要进行特殊处理才能正确加载。...这样,无论子应用在哪里运行,图片都可以正确地加载。 使用 qiankun 时,你如何处理老项目的资源加载问题?你能给出一些具体的解决方案吗?...使用 iframe 嵌入老项目:虽然 qiankun 支持 jQuery 老项目,但是似乎对多应用没有很好的解决办法。...子项目复用主项目的依赖可以通过给子项目的index.html中的公共依赖的script和link标签添加自定义属性ignore来实现。

    93710

    如何在低代码平台中引用 JavaScript ?

    我们举一个简单的实例,添加一个 JavaScript 文件,文件内写一个简单的加法方法。 接下来,我们面上就可以调用这里的 add 方法。...活字格内置了JQuery3.6.0库(活字格V10.0版本),可以脚本中直接使用JQuery功能。...; 实现效果如下所示: 引入JavaScript API 通过上面演示,可以看到,活字格中可以通过 JavaScript 操作页面、单元格,除此之外,还可以操作页面上的表格,接下来我们通过一个示例来演示下如何操作表格...操作步骤 1、设计器运行设计器中运行应用; 2、浏览器中按F12打开开发者工具,选择“源代码”(Sources); 可以看到,我们加入的 JavaScript 和 CSS 代码GeneratedResources...3、找到对应的代码后,浏览器控制台给代码添加断点,即可进行运行调试。

    17310

    探索 JQuery EasyUI:构建简单易用的前端页面

    我们还设置了分页按钮的布局,包括列表、分隔符、首页、上一、页码链接、下一、尾、分隔符和刷新按钮。...用户可以面上看到用户列表,点击“Add User”按钮可以弹出添加用户的对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库中。...用户可以面上选择不同类型的图表(柱状图、折线图、饼图),然后点击对应的按钮,页面就会加载相应类型的模拟数据并绘制图表。...用户可以面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务的对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库中,同时也可以删除已有的任务。...总结希望通过本篇博客的学习,读者可以掌握 JQuery EasyUI 的基本用法,并且了解如何利用 EasyUI 开发各种类型的前端应用程序。加油加油!

    52610

    探索 JQuery EasyUI:构建简单易用的前端页面

    我们还设置了分页按钮的布局,包括列表、分隔符、首页、上一、页码链接、下一、尾、分隔符和刷新按钮。...用户可以面上看到用户列表,点击“Add User”按钮可以弹出添加用户的对话框,输入用户信息后点击“Save”按钮即可将用户信息保存到后端数据库中。...用户可以面上选择不同类型的图表(柱状图、折线图、饼图),然后点击对应的按钮,页面就会加载相应类型的模拟数据并绘制图表。...用户可以面上看到任务列表,点击工具栏按钮可以弹出添加或编辑任务的对话框,输入任务信息后点击保存按钮即可将任务信息保存到后端数据库中,同时也可以删除已有的任务。...总结 希望通过本篇博客的学习,读者可以掌握 JQuery EasyUI 的基本用法,并且了解如何利用 EasyUI 开发各种类型的前端应用程序。加油加油!(ง •_•)ง

    7610

    【SaaS应用程序】上海道宁为您提供研究数据管理-库存管理-调度工具——LabArchives

    (评分、作业创建者、与Blackboard、Canvas、Moodle的集成、实验室手册出版等)。...02、产品功能1、使用简单:单击一次,添加一些详细信息。预订完成。2、强大地可配置性:LabArchives Scheduler旨在以您组织的任何方式工作。...4、高效率运行:安排实验室时间、实验室设备预订,甚至 会议室。支持保持社交距离。...通过一个导入模板来上传您的库存信息,它按库存类型组织,可以 LabArchives 库存的实验室管理部分进行自定义。02、轻松设置1、用户角色可确保:实验室成员之间的一致性并遵守政策。...LabArchives API已用于: 自动上传机器生成的数据 笔记本中添加指向存储机构存储库中的外部数据的链接,反之亦然 分析笔记本数据 实现笔记本数据的复杂搜索 自定义预配置用户帐户和笔记本

    97020
    领券